Defining The Niche: Cosmetic Surgery SEO Compared To General Medical SEO
Cosmetic surgery SEO focuses on procedure-specific searches and local intent. Patients seek specific outcomes and nearby providers. For example, they may search for “best rhinoplasty surgeon in San Francisco.” That makes local signals and reviews especially important for ranking.
General medical SEO, on the other hand, targets broader topics like symptoms or chronic care. Cosmetic practices need to showcase before-and-after photos, patient testimonials, and clear booking options. This approach changes the content, schema markup, and link-building strategies.
How To Prioritize Keywords For A Cosmetic Surgery Practice
Start with an audit to identify current keywords, traffic levels, and conversions. Group keywords by intent: navigational, informational, and transactional. Then prioritize transactional keywords with strong local intent to drive bookings.
Utilize tools like Google Keyword Planner and SEMrush to analyze volume and competition. Examine competitor pages to identify gaps and opportunities. Concentrate on long-tail, geo-specific phrases like “affordable facelift in Miami” to attract local leads.
| Keyword Category | Example | Main Page | Objective |
|---|---|---|---|
| Transactional | book rhinoplasty consultation near me | Service page with booking CTA | Lead / appointment |
| Educational | what happens after facelift surgery | Educational article or guide | Build trust / educate |
| Local Long-Tail | best nose surgeon in San Francisco | Local landing page | Qualified local inquiries |
| Brand Search | Smith Aesthetics ratings | Practice homepage or Google Business Profile | Users looking for the brand |
Develop a content plan that aligns with intent. Prioritize transactional service pages for high-value procedures. Then add informational content clusters to support those pages and build trust.
Track results and adjust priorities based on search volume, local competition, and revenue per procedure. This approach will inform effective SEO strategies for plastic surgeons and provide actionable tips for growth.
Website Foundation And Technical SEO For Cosmetic Surgeon Website Optimization
A strong technical foundation is essential for cosmetic surgery SEO to perform well. Practices should focus on speed, mobile-first design, and security. That helps visitors access pages quickly and trust the site when considering consultations.
Speed is critical. Compress images, enable browser caching, and reduce JavaScript and CSS to enhance load times. A reliable host and content delivery network are key to maintaining page speed under heavy traffic. Faster pages often lead to a better user experience and stronger search rankings.
Mobile-first design is vital because mobile searches and Google Maps usage are so common. Opt for responsive templates, simplify navigation, and ensure buttons and booking forms are accessible. Also secure every page with SSL/HTTPS to protect patient data and satisfy search engine trust signals.
A well-structured website with clean URLs makes content easier to crawl. Group procedures by category, create local landing pages, and use descriptive URLs. Submit an XML sitemap and manage robots.txt. Regularly review indexability in Google Search Console to spot issues early.
Structured data can improve how search results appear. Use MedicalBusiness, Physician, and Review schema to display provider details and ratings. Add alt text and transcripts for multimedia to enhance relevance.
Technical reviews should be performed regularly and kept simple to audit. Verify canonical tags, hreflang if necessary, and internal links. Test forms for secure submission and confirm booking confirmations reach patients.

On-Page Content Strategy For Optimizing Cosmetic Surgery Websites
Effective on-page SEO begins with creating focused pages that align with patient needs. Cosmetic surgeon websites should include dedicated pages for every procedure and location. These pages should feature local signals, FAQs, contact or booking CTAs, and before-and-after galleries to improve relevance for specific searches.
Service pages should follow a clear, straightforward structure. Begin with a short overview, outline benefits and ideal candidates, and then provide a step-by-step explanation. Finish with recovery timelines and pricing details. Place a prominent booking CTA above the fold and repeat it near case studies or galleries to increase conversions.
Local landing pages should show location details, office hours, and a map. Include local FAQs that use neighborhood names and common queries. Accurate NAP listings and citations combined with these pages can improve local visibility.
Trust signals are key to converting visitors into patients. Place board certifications, patient testimonials, and before-and-after photos prominently. Include video testimonials and transcripts for search engine indexing. Detailed case studies and procedure walkthroughs answer questions and reduce hesitation.
Titles, meta descriptions, and headings guide both users and search engines. Use H1 for the main topic and H2/H3 for subtopics to maintain a clear hierarchy. Include primary keywords naturally in title tags and meta descriptions to improve click-through rates. Regularly update older pages with fresh outcomes, new photos, and current FAQs.
Image optimization is important for both load speed and accessibility. Use descriptive filenames and alt text that match the procedure or location. Add structured data like review schema and FAQ schema to enhance search results.
Internal links help users and distribute authority. Connect service pages to related blog posts, pricing pages, and location pages. Make contact methods prominent: a tappable phone number, short contact forms, and clear booking buttons improve mobile conversions.

Google Business Profile Optimization For Cosmetic Surgery
Make sure every GBP field is completed: practice name, address, phone number, categories, services, and business hours. Upload high-quality before-and-after photos and team images to build credibility. Post regular updates about promotions, events, and new services to boost engagement and GBP impressions.
Use service listings that match patient queries. Link location-specific landing pages directly to the profile. Monitor GBP insights to see which search terms and actions lead to calls or directions.
Managing Local Citations, NAP Consistency, And Directory Listings
Review citations across RealSelf, Healthgrades, Yelp, Zocdoc, and local chamber directories. Make sure the name, address, and phone number (NAP) match exactly across every listing. Even small formatting differences can weaken local authority and confuse search engines.
Build location pages for each clinic using unique content and schema markup. Use consistent location keywords in headings and meta content to support maps rankings for neighborhood searches.
Review Management And Reputation Signals
Solicit Google reviews from satisfied patients with clear, compliant workflows. Encourage posts on third-party sites such as RealSelf and Yelp for broader reputation reach. Respond to reviews promptly and professionally to show care and attention.
Feature positive review excerpts on service pages and in ad copy. Implement review schema to help search engines display ratings in local results. Track sentiment trends and address recurring concerns to protect conversion rates.

High-Quality Backlinks And PR
Target health and beauty publications such as WebMD, RealSelf, and Allure for authoritative links and broader visibility. Create thought leadership content for medical journals and trade publications. That content may be cited by reporters and bloggers, which can further strengthen your online presence.
Create compelling patient stories with consent and clear outcomes. Local newspapers and regional lifestyle magazines often feature these stories, generating natural backlinks and referral traffic.
Building Referral Partnerships And Local Sponsorships
Build referral partnerships with dermatologists, med spas, and ENT clinics to support mutual patient flow and cross-linking. Community sponsorships, hospital affiliations, and charity events also create opportunities for press coverage and local citations.
Track the effectiveness of these partnerships in sending visits and improving domain authority. Focus on building relationships that offer both referrals and credible backlinks, supporting your off-page SEO efforts.
Monitoring Backlink Profile And Disavow Strategy
Utilize Google Search Console, Ahrefs, or Moz to monitor backlinks and identify low-quality or spammy links. Review new links regularly and flag suspicious sources that could damage rankings.
Prepare a disavow file when needed to address toxic links. Consistent monitoring is essential for protecting your link-building and reputation management investments.

Core Metrics And KPIs To Track
Track organic sessions, local ranking positions, and conversion volume. Track phone calls, online booking completions, and contact form leads. Review behavioral signals such as bounce rate, pages per session, and average session duration to catch content or UX issues early.
Dashboards And Tools
Use Google Analytics and Google Search Console for foundational reporting. Integrate rank trackers and CRM attribution to link visits to revenue. Set up goal tracking and UTM parameters so campaign ROI can be measured accurately. Maintain a weekly-updated dashboard that highlights trends in organic sessions, local map impressions, and goal completions.
Evaluating An SEO Agency Or SEO Services For Cosmetic Surgery Practices
Request documented case studies that demonstrate percentage increases in organic sessions, booked consults, phone calls, and local rankings. Confirm experience with multi-location practices and adherence to medical compliance requirements. Require transparent reporting, clear KPIs, and ethical tactics before moving forward.
